*Sean “Diddy” Combs, the legendary hip hop mogul and pioneer, is set to receive the prestigious Global Icon Award at the 2023 Video Music Awards (VMAs). The awards show will air on Tuesday, September 12 at 8 PM ET/PT from the Prudential Center in New Jersey. Diddy will receive the Global Icon Award for his unparalleled career and continued influence that has achieved unrivaled global success in music and beyond.

Combs, whose worldwide impact has endured for more than three decades including two #1 albums on the Billboard 200 and eleven #1 singles on the Billboard charts, will also make a highly anticipated return to the iconic MTV stage. This marks his first performance at the VMAs since 2005.

In addition to receiving the Global Icon Award, Diddy is also nominated for four other awards this year for “Gotta Move On: Queens remix ” and his work on “Creepin” (Remix). His nominations include two for “Best Collaboration,” as well as “Best Rap” and “Best R&B.”

The Global Icon Award, originally from MTV’s Europe Music Awards (EMAs), celebrates an artist or band whose unparalleled career and continued influence have achieved a unique level of global success in music and beyond. Diddy also hosted MTV Europe Music Awards 2002 at the Palazzo Sant Jordi, Barcelona, Spain.

Diddy has a storied history with the VMAs, with memorable moments dating back to his debut performance of “Mo Money Mo Problems” in 1997. He returned to the stage in 2002 to perform a medley of “Bad Boy For Life” and “I Need A Girl (Parts 1 & 2).” In 2005, Diddy hosted the VMAs from Miami, leading an orchestra into a performance featuring Snoop Dogg on stage and a video performance from the late Notorious B.I.G. In his first year as a nominee, Diddy won a Moonman for “Best R&B Video” (1997) and later won the “Viewer’s Choice” award (1998). This year’s VMAs will mark his ninth appearance.

Diddy recently announced his highly anticipated R&B masterpiece “The Love Album: Off the Grid” dropping on Diddy Day, September 15th, 2023. Under his LOVE Records imprint, the new album signifies Diddy’s triumphant return since his critically acclaimed solo album “Last Train to Paris” in 2010.
